Coping And Resilience Inventory (CARI)

Coping And Resilience Inventory
(CARI)

Turning Adversities Into Opportunities

The CARI is a questionnaire that measures Resilience, the ability to deal with stress and to overcome adversity.

Building Resilience helps equip people with the skills they need to thrive in the face of challenges before they arise.

Kosh Resilience Framework

The CARI explains a person’s Resilience in terms of three main Resilience Factors (Coping Capacities, Coping Processes, and Coping Buffers) based on our proprietary Kosh Resilience Framework. Quick Facts

116 Questions Long.
Untimed. Generally takes 20 – 30 minutes to complete.
Gain a holistic picture of how Resilience functions, and how it can be applied at work.
Uses simple, easily understood international English.

Other VersionsYouth Resilience Inventory (YRI)

A version of the CARI is designed to be more relevant to educational and school settings, and uses simpler language and more academic-oriented examples in its questions. It uses the same framework as the CARI and has the same features.
